Output 3242f31352ffaec68d4f706f8d17e09874c1dcb246d699186fc9783b9155c64b:1

value
173336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abf2f9c4b5c88af348e7eb0cfe089a82063ae28 OP_EQUAL
address
3P6F5GRbFr1VDfuK6La7z4WscdoS9SvMFp
transaction
3242f31352ffaec68d4f706f8d17e09874c1dcb246d699186fc9783b9155c64b
confirmations
122184
spent
true